Write a third degree polynomial function y=P(x) with rational coefficients so that P(x)=0 has the given roots.
1, 2-i and 2+i
-----
P(x) = (x-1)(x-2+i)(x-2-i)
----
= (x-1)[(x-2)+i)(x-2)-i)]
----
= (x-1)[(x-2)^2+1]
----
= (x-1)(x^2-4x+5)
----
= x^3 - 5x^2 + 9x -5
